Weenthunga established our djilba biik (formerly Social and Emotional Wellbeing) Space in 2022 as a way to "care for the carers" - people in the community who keep us strong and well through their health, wellbeing, and healing roles. djilba biik in Woiwurrung means "protected ground". The Space was established to improve the retention and wellbeing of the First Nations health workforce by providing wellbeing backing.

Following the success and outcomes of this Space, and the significant community need expressed by our Members and Networks, we expanded our djilba biik Space to a cohort of 25 First Nations men, brotherboys and non-binary mob in health.

This role will continue on the success of our current Men's djilba biik Space by backing the wellbeing of an existing cohort of First Nations mob in health. This includes through hosting an annual overnight event, one-on-one engagement to back self-determined wellbeing needs, facilitation of experiences, opportunities and connections to enhance wellbeing, and capturing the impacts of these activities for the wellbeing and retention of participating First Nations mob in health. Where capacity allows, there is also an opportunity to grow and expand the cohort.

As an outreach role, you will have the opportunity to work-from-home and within the community - "meeting mob where they're at".
